    #include <bits/stdc++.h>
    using namespace std;
    #define lc (p << 1)
    #define rc (p << 1 | 1)
    #define mid (tr[p].l + tr[p].r) / 2
    const int N = 1e6 + 10;
    vector<pair<int, int>> G[N];
    int fa[N], son[N], dep[N], f[N][20], D, siz[N], a[N];
    void dfs1(int x, int ff)
    {
      fa[x] = ff;
      dep[x] = dep[ff] + 1;
      siz[x] = 1;
      f[x][0] = ff;
      for (int i = 1; i <= D; i++)
        f[x][i] = f[f[x][i - 1]][i - 1];
      for (auto i : G[x])
      {
        int y = i.first, c = i.second;
        if (y == ff)
          continue;
        dfs1(y, x);
        a[y] = c;
        siz[x] += siz[y];
        if (siz[son[x]] < siz[y])
          son[x] = y;
      }
    }
    
    int tsp, dfn[N], top[N], ys[N];
    void dfs2(int x, int tp)
    {
      dfn[x] = ++tsp;
      ys[tsp] = x;
      top[x] = tp;
      if (son[x] != 0)
        dfs2(son[x], tp);
      for (auto i : G[x])
      {
        int y = i.first, c = i.second;
        if (y != fa[x] && y != son[x])
          dfs2(y, y);
      }
    }
    
    struct trnode
    {
      int l, r, c;
    } tr[N << 2];
    void upd(int p) { tr[p].c = tr[lc].c + tr[rc].c; }
    void bt(int p, int l, int r)
    {
      tr[p] = {l, r, 0};
      if (l == r)
        tr[p].c = a[ys[l]];
      else
      {
        bt(lc, l, mid);
        bt(rc, mid + 1, r);
        upd(p);
      }
    }
    int query(int p, int l, int r)
    {
      if (l <= tr[p].l && tr[p].r <= r)
        return tr[p].c;
      int res = 0;
      if (l <= mid)
        res += query(lc, l, r);
      if (mid < r)
        res += query(rc, l, r);
      return res;
    }
    int solve(int x, int y)
    {
      int res = 0;
      while (top[x] != top[y])
      {
        if (dep[top[x]] < dep[top[y]])
          swap(x, y);
        res += query(1, dfn[top[x]], dfn[x]);
        x = fa[top[x]];
      }
      if (dep[x] > dep[y])
        swap(x, y);
      if (x != y)
        res += query(1, dfn[x] + 1, dfn[y]);
      return res;
    }
    int lca(int x, int y)
    {
      if (dep[x] < dep[y])
        swap(x, y);
      for (int i = D; i >= 0; i--)
        if (dep[f[x][i]] >= dep[y])
          x = f[x][i];
      if (x == y)
        return x;
      for (int i = D; i >= 0; i--)
        if (f[x][i] != f[y][i])
          x = f[x][i], y = f[y][i];
      return f[x][0];
    }
    int path(int x, int y, int k)
    {
      int p = lca(x, y);
      if (k <= dep[x] - dep[p] + 1)
      {
        k--;
        for (int i = D; i >= 0; i--)
          if (k >= (1 << i))
            x = f[x][i], k -= (1 << i);
        return x;
      }
      else
      {
        k = (dep[x] + dep[y] - 2 * dep[p] + 1) - k + 1;
        k--;
        for (int i = D; i >= 0; i--)
          if (k >= (1 << i))
            y = f[y][i], k -= (1 << i);
        return y;
      }
    }
    int main()
    {
      int T;
      scanf("%d", &T);
      while (T--)
      {
        int n;
        scanf("%d", &n);
        memset(G, 0, sizeof(G));
        for (int i = 1, x, y, c; i < n; i++)
        {
          scanf("%d%d%d", &x, &y, &c);
          G[x].push_back({y, c});
          G[y].push_back({x, c});
        }
        fa[0] = dep[0] = siz[0] = 0;
        memset(son, 0, sizeof(son));
        a[1] = 0;
        D = log2(n);
        dfs1(1, 0);
        tsp = 0;
        dfs2(1, 1);
        bt(1, 1, tsp);
        char s[10];
        while (scanf("%s", s) != EOF && s[1] != 'O')
        {
          if (s[0] == 'D')
          {
            int x, y;
            scanf("%d%d", &x, &y);
            printf("%d\n", solve(x, y));
          }
          else
          {
            int x, y, k;
            scanf("%d%d%d", &x, &y, &k);
            printf("%d\n", path(x, y, k));
          }
        }
      }
      return 0;
    }
